London : The Fleetway House , 1927 . First Edition . VG . 4TO . Coloured frontis and three colour plates, lots of black and white illustrations. Lots of stirring fiction and many articles. Bound in pictorial boards, brown cloth spine. Edgewear, lower front corner worn. A heavy book.
